[The effect of aminophylline on the sinoatrial node].

Authors: J, Pella; B, Stancák; J, Bodnár; Z, Schroner; J, Sedlák;

[The effect of aminophylline on the sinoatrial node].

Abstract

The objective of the submitted prospective study was to assess the influence of intravenously administered aminophylline on the sinoatrial node. The authors examined by electrophysiological methods 20 patients (16 without dysfunction of the sinoatrial node and 4 with dysfunction of the sinoatrial node). From the investigation patients were eliminated with an apparent and obvious cause of elevated uric acid serum levels and patients where on electrophysiological examination limited values of the corrected recovery time of the sinoatrial node were found (from 650 ms to 999 ms). To all 20 patients 240 mg aminophylline were administered by the i.v. route with in 2 mins. The following parameters were recorded: age, serum level of uric acid, basal heart rate in ms, corrected recovery time of the sinoatrial node in ms, heart rate and corrected recovery time of the sinoatrial node 5 min after completed administration of aminohpylline in ms. As regards age and uric acid serum levels there was no significant difference between dysfunction of the sinoatrial node and normal function of the sinoatrial node. Intravenously administered aminophylline hastened significantly the heart rate in patients without dysfunction of the sinoatrial node (p < 0.05). The value of the corrected recovery time of the sinoatrial node was shorter but the difference was not statistically significant. In patients with dysfunction of the sinoatrial node aminophylline did not affect the heart rate and corrected recovery time of the sinoatrial node.
